WebMay 19, 2024 · (1) Both clients had to set up their own Government Gateway accounts. (2) They then set up Capital Gains Tax Service accounts. They were given the long reference number which they sent to me. (3) I logged on to my ASA account and asked that they appointed me as agent. (4) I got sent a digital link which I sent to them. WebThe rate of Capital Gains Tax on the sale of residential property will be either 18% or 28% depending on your other income on the same tax year. A tax year is 6 April – 5th April. If you sell or ‘dispose of’ and asset i.e. a property and make a profit, you should pay capital gains tax to HMRC on the profit received.
